3D Printing in Oral Surgery
To improve the area of dental surgery, you can check out the subtopic of 3D printing in oral surgery. This ingenious modern technology has the prospective to change the way dental cosmetic surgeons run and treat people. Right here are four key ways in which 3D printing is forming the field:
- ** Custom-made Surgical Guides **: 3D printing enables the development of highly precise and patient-specific medical overviews, boosting the precision and efficiency of treatments.
- ** Implant Prosthetics **: With 3D printing, dental cosmetic surgeons can develop personalized dental implant prosthetics that completely fit a patient's special makeup, leading to better results and patient fulfillment.
- ** Bone Grafting **: 3D printing allows the production of patient-specific bone grafts, minimizing the requirement for standard implanting methods and enhancing recovery and healing time.
- ** Education and learning and Educating **: 3D printing can be made use of to create realistic surgical designs for instructional objectives, allowing dental specialists to exercise complex treatments prior to performing them on patients.
With its potential to boost precision, personalization, and training, 3D printing is an interesting advancement in the field of dental surgery.
Minimally Invasive Strategies
To additionally progress the area of oral surgery, accept the capacity of minimally invasive techniques that can considerably benefit both surgeons and people alike.
Minimally intrusive techniques are revolutionizing the field by decreasing surgical injury, minimizing post-operative pain, and increasing the healing process. These methods involve using smaller sized lacerations and specialized instruments to perform treatments with accuracy and performance.
By using innovative imaging modern technology, such as cone light beam computed tomography (CBCT), cosmetic surgeons can precisely intend and perform surgical procedures with marginal invasiveness.
In addition, making use of lasers in oral surgery allows for specific cells cutting and coagulation, causing decreased blood loss and minimized healing time.
With minimally invasive strategies, individuals can experience faster healing, lowered scarring, and enhanced end results, making it a vital aspect of the future of dental surgery.
